The Evolution of Gaming Platforms

Over the past decade, the landscape of online gaming has shifted dramatically. In 2022, mobile gaming accounted for approximately 57% of the total gaming market, a trend that shows no signs of slowing down. This shift can be attributed to several factors:

  • Accessibility: Mobile devices allow players to gamble anywhere, anytime.
  • User Experience: Mobile applications often provide tailored interfaces for smaller screens.
  • Technological Advancements: Improved mobile hardware supports high-definition graphics and complex gameplay.

Advantages of Mobile Gaming: Portability and Convenience

Mobile gaming offers unique advantages that appeal to modern players:

  • Portability: Players can engage with their favorite games during commutes or breaks.
  • Instant Access: With one tap, players can initiate games without the need to boot up a PC.
  • Exclusive Promotions: Many casinos offer mobile-specific bonuses, enhancing the overall experience.

Desktop Gaming: A Case for the Classic Experience

Despite the rise of mobile gaming, desktop platforms maintain a loyal following due to several inherent benefits:

  • Screen Size: Larger displays facilitate a more immersive gaming experience.
  • Performance: Desktops typically handle graphics-intensive games more efficiently.
  • Multi-Tasking: Players can easily switch between games or applications.

Hidden Risks: Security and Connectivity

While both platforms offer robust gaming experiences, they also come with unique risks:

  • Mobile: Increased vulnerability to unsecured Wi-Fi networks can expose players to data breaches.
  • Desktop: Desktop users may face risks from outdated software and malware if not maintained properly.
